Hi all,

I have been wanting to get to Wootton Bassett for months to attend a repatriation day so that I can hand out our cards during the build up to the ceremony. I have been told they would be very warmly received but sadly the only thing preventing me getting there is a lack of pennies.

If any of you live nearby and would like to meet up and do the honours of handing out our cards, to what must be the most appropriate group of people we could find, please let me know and I shall arrange cards to be sent to your address. My ex army colleague who attended the last one said it was an experience he would always cherish. It was he who said to get the cards out there asap, he said there are so many strong supporters of our troops there they would be swallowed up.
